Accountable for developing, managing, coordinating, networking, implementing and monitoring advocacy and communication related strategies and associated products and activities to build child rights champions and support UNICEF's mission in Ukraine. The role includes communication strategy development, digital content production, media relations, networking, event management, and capacity building.

Responsibilities

  • Develop, manage, coordinate, network, implement and monitor advocacy and communication strategies and associated products and activities.
  • Ensure a clear communication approach and work plan to support advocacy and country programme objectives.
  • Strengthen public and political will in support of UNICEF's mission and enhance the organization’s credibility and brand.
  • Ensure effective digital content production plan and capacity for engaging and powerful content.
  • Maintain and develop contact lists of journalists and media outlets and ensure regular collaboration with media.
  • Maintain and develop contact lists of individuals, groups, organizations and fora essential for advocacy and communication objectives.
  • Engage nationally-known personalities to support UNICEF’s efforts and participate in special events.
  • Integrate and take action on UNICEF’s global communications priorities and campaigns locally.
  • Support global and country level fund-raising activities through effective advocacy and communication.
  • Manage human resources and financial resources effectively.
  • Establish communication baselines and regularly evaluate achievement of communication strategy objectives.
  • Provide professional expertise and advice on external relations communication and build communication capacity among country communication team, media and partners.

Requirements

  • Master or equivalent (Advanced University Degree) in Communications, Public Relations/Communication, Journalism, Public Affairs, Corporate Communications, External Relations and any other related fields.
  • At least 5 years of relevant work experience in Communication, Broadcasting, Media, Communication, Print, Broadcast, New Media and any other related fields.
  • Skills in Digital Content, Media Relations, Programme Policies, Rights‑Based Programming, Administrative Guidelines, Communication Standards.
  • English - Proficient/Fluent.
  • Desirable: Knowledge of another official UN language (Arabic, Chinese, French, Russian or Spanish) or a local language.
  • Desirable: Relevant experience at country level, particularly in development, fragile settings and humanitarian contexts.
